So rechnen Sie Zentimeter in Chi um
Um Zentimeter in Chi umzurechnen, verwenden Sie folgende Formel:
尺 = cm × 0.03
Beispiel: 1 cm = 0.03 尺
Zum Beispiel: 5 cm = 0.15 尺, 10 cm = 0.3 尺 und 100 cm = 3 尺. Für größere Werte: 1000 cm = 30 尺. Umgekehrt: 1 尺 = 33.33333333 cm. Unser Rechner führt diese Umrechnung sofort mit voller Präzision durch — ohne Rundungsfehler.

Was ist ein Zentimeter?
The centimeter (cm) is a metric unit of length equal to one-hundredth of a meter (0.01 m). It is part of the International System of Units (SI) and is defined based on the meter.
Centimeters are commonly used worldwide for everyday measurements where meters are too large, such as human height, furniture dimensions, and textile measurements.
Was ist ein Chi?
A traditional Chinese unit of length (尺). Standardized as 1/3 of a meter.
Still used in China for measuring cloth, clothing sizes, and construction.
